Ryan Takao is in his third season as head coach of the Trinity Tigers women's tennis team. 

Coach Takao has guided the Tigers to a 22-19 dual-match record, and a berth in the Southern Collegiate Athletic Conference Championship match. Each season, his players have qualified for the NCAA Division III  Singles and Doubles Championships.

He was an assistant coach with the Tigers for 12 years, before assuming the helm in 2009. Coach Takao was the assistant when Trinity captured the NCAA national championship in 2000.

Coach Takao earned the Bachelor of Arts in humanities from Trinity in 1996 and was a four-year letterman on the Tiger men's team. He helped lead the Tigers to three consecutive SCAC titles as a player. Coach Takao was named to the All-SCAC Team twice in his career, and spearheaded Trinity to four NCAA postseason appearances.

He played at Theodore Roosevelt High School in San Antonio, and was the team's No. 1 singles and doubles player for his last three years. Coach Takao advanced to the Class 5A Region round of 16 in singles in 1990 and 1991. He also played doubles with his brother, Mikey (a former Trinity player, as well) and finished third in regionals in 1992.

Coach Takao received the Boys 18's Texas Super Championship Art Faust Sportsmanship Award in 1991 and 1992. In 1989, he played on the San Antonio National City Tennis Team. The Takao family was also chosen as the San Antonio Family of the Year by the San Antonio Tennis Association in 1989.

Coach Takao's highest junior ranking in Texas was 11th, but he was also ranked the No. 1 doubles team in the state, with his father, in 1990.

He is a certified United States Professional Tennis Association instructor, and teaches in San Antonio. 

 Coach Takao and his wife, Cari, reside in San Antonio.
